flask_login_dictabase_blueprint

A Flask Blueprint for managing users.

Example App

import time

from flask import render_template, flash, jsonify

from flask_login_dictabase_blueprint import (
    verify_is_user,
    verify_is_admin,
    new_user,
    forgot_password,
    on_magic_link_created,
    add_admin,
    get_users,
    get_current_user,
    on_signin,
    do_render_template,
    menu,
    get_app
)

app = get_app({
    'SECRET_KEY': 'random_string',
})


@app.route('/')
def index():
    """This page is visible to anyone (logged in or not)."""
    return render_template('index.html', user=get_current_user())


@app.route('/private')
@verify_is_user
def private():
    """This page is only viewable to logged-in users."""
    return render_template('private.html', user=get_current_user())


add_admin('grant@grant-miller.com')  # You can add one or more "admins"


@app.route('/admin')
@verify_is_admin
def admin():
    """This page is only viewable by the admins."""
    return render_template(
        'admin.html',
        users=get_users(),
        user=get_current_user(),
    )


@new_user
def new_user_callback(user):
    """Called whenever a new user is created."""
    print('NewUserCallback(user=', user)
    flash(f'Welcome new user {user["email"]}')


@forgot_password
def forgot_password_callback(user, forgot_url):
    """Called when a user requests to reset their password. You should email the forgot_url to the user."""
    print('ForgotPasswordCallback(user=', user, forgot_url)
    flash('Send an email with the forgot_url to the user', 'info')


@on_magic_link_created
def magic_link_callback(user, magic_link):
    """Used to simplify login. Email the magic_link to the user. If they click on the magic_link, they will be logged in."""
    print('MagicLinkCallback(user=', user, magic_link)
    flash('Send an email with the magic link to the user', 'info')


@on_signin
def signed_in_callback(user):
    print(f'SignedIn {user["email"]}')


@do_render_template
def render_template_callback(template_name):
    print('RenderTemplateCallback(templateName=', template_name)
    return {
        'message': f'The time is {time.asctime()}',
        'title': 'My Title',
    }


menu.AddMenuOption('Test Title', '/test_url', adminOnly=False)
menu.AddMenuOption('Admin Title', '/admin_url', adminOnly=True)
menu.AddMenuOption('User Title', '/user_url', userOnly=True)


@app.route('/menu')
def menu_view():
    return jsonify(menu.GetMenu())


if __name__ == '__main__':
    app.run(debug=True)
